Q.

My baby is two and half month old, she doesn't take breastmilk, even after trying a lot, which is why she is only depending on formula milk. what should I do. she was a premature baby, doctor said she is too weak to suck breastmilk in the beginning. But she weights 3.8 now, but still she is doesn't suck my milk.

1 Answer
POOJA KOTHARIMom of a 8 yr 5 m old boy4 years ago
A. If your baby's doctor thinks it's necessary, you may have to supplement your baby with additional feedings of either pumped breast milk or infant formula. You can also try to pump and separate your foremilk from your hindmilk. Hindmilk is higher in fat and calories, which can help your baby gain more weight.
